Müller-Lyer Illusion
A visual illusion in which two lines of the same length appear to be of different lengths due to the placement of arrow-like figures at the ends.
Horizontal-Vertical Illusion
A visual illusion where the perception of length is distorted; horizontal segments appear longer than vertical ones of the same length.
Relative Size
Relative size is a visual perception cue where the size of an object, when compared with another, helps determine depth or distance in a two-dimensional representation.
Timbre
The quality of a musical note, sound, or tone that distinguishes different types of sound production, such as voices or musical instruments.
